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9179242 537251 185811 6328397333 27181067553
771161748 48211448
771161748 48211448
15 19 929 086095078
All about undefined
Interested in learning more?
771161748 48211448
15 19 929 086095078
See more
06 3878026538
71185 38132209193 151 26125913 3813
See more
0983483333 0781055608
8324 2405019 40566 491201551
See more